Original Oyster House Names Employees Of The Year

Original Oyster House restaurants closed early this month for their annual Christmas parties to celebrate employees. The Employee of the Year monetary awards were presented to a back-of-the-house staff member and a front-of-the-house staff member at each location who exemplify the company’s mission, core values and excellence. For Mobile, they are Anna Moyers, front-of-the-house cashier, and Angela Sykes, back-of the-house prep. For Gulf Shores, they are Travis Hines, front-of-the-house busser, and Rondolph “Randy” Howe, back-of-the-house line cook. Employees of the Year are selected from the pool of 12 Employees of Month. Those employees were, sequentially, Levorn Jackson, Ashley Kimmel, Moyers, Lukelin Chambers, Sykes, Netta Hooks, Emmitt Handy, Thaddius Davis, Margaret King, Sommer Amison, Karen Taubel and Shelby Mendoza in Mobile. In Gulf Shores, they were Cassie Fye, Heloisa Canchola, G.G. Henry, Kristopher Nichols, Rashaun Lennox, Tetiana Lotuha, Rocco Basile, Hines, Lucas Barbosa, Kian Morgan and Jaroslav Kosina.
